An accounting firm's calendar is punishing and non-negotiable. Payroll deadlines, quarterly filings, extensions, and April 15 dominate the year, and every one of them requires software that works, files that are reachable, and clients whose data is safe.

We support CPA firms, tax-only practices, bookkeeping firms, and full-service accounting groups across Las Vegas. Our engagements center on three deliverables: reliability during tax season, IRS Publication 4557 and FTC Safeguards Rule alignment, and secure client document exchange that doesn't rely on email attachments.

The Federal Trade Commission's revised Safeguards Rule now applies directly to tax preparers and CPAs. Written Information Security Plans, MFA, encryption, and vendor oversight are no longer optional — they are examinable.

How the day runs

Daily operational workflows

  1. 1Client intake: source documents arrive via secure portal (SmartVault, ShareFile, Canopy) — not personal email — and route to the assigned preparer.
  2. 2Preparation: work happens in Drake, UltraTax, Lacerte, ProConnect, or ProSystem fx; e-file transmissions run reliably during peak windows.
  3. 3Review: partners review returns in-app or on PDF proofs; changes flow back to the preparer's queue.
  4. 4Delivery: signed engagement letters, e-file authorizations, and completed returns are delivered through the secure portal and archived.
  5. 5Bookkeeping ops: QuickBooks / QuickBooks Online, Xero, and Sage Intacct engagements run continuously with monthly close deadlines.

Regulatory

Compliance considerations

IRS Publication 4557

'Safeguarding Taxpayer Data' baseline — encryption, MFA, monitoring, documented policies, and incident response.

FTC Safeguards Rule (Gramm-Leach-Bliley)

Written Information Security Plan, qualified individual, risk assessment, vendor oversight, employee training, and periodic testing.

State breach-notification law

Nevada NRS 603A defines protected personal information and breach obligations.

Threat model

Cybersecurity risks unique to this industry

Tax-preparer credential phishing

Fake IRS and 'e-file update required' phishing targets preparers directly. Advanced mail filtering plus MFA is table stakes.

Business email compromise

Wire-instruction fraud around client refunds and vendor payments is common. Banner rules and out-of-band verification are standard.

Ransomware during peak season

A ransomware event on April 8 is an existence-level event. Immutable backups and rehearsed restore procedures matter more here than almost anywhere.
